Description#
Incredibly unique and spacious 1 bedroom 1.5 bathroom in a landmarked converted school in Cobble Hill. The occupancy date is August 1st (but flexible) and pets on approval. The apartment: This first-floor western exposed apartment has a double height entryway with a small staircase that that leads up and into the apartment. This roomy space has a coat closet, excellent storage and easy access to the power room. Warm western exposed sunlight shines through this home through two rows of casement windows equipped with insulated soundproof city windows and modern electric solar shades. The eat-in-kitchen has an open layout with black granite countertops, a classic white subway tile backsplash and rich wood cabinetry. Kitchen appliances include a stainless steel and black lacquer Bosch electric stove, GE stainless steel refrigerator and a black Kenmore dishwasher. Off the living room through an oversized sliding glass door is the king-sized bedroom. This is a sunny space with an en suite bathroom and extra-large double closet. The en suite bathroom features glass tiling, a modern sink and a glass enclosed soaking tub/shower with recessed shelving. Both bathrooms come with Robern luxury medicine cabinets, Italian porcelain tile floors and Toto toilets. The apartment offers recessed lighting, custom shelving, wood floors and a space saving natural light enhancing sliding door. There is an in-unit utility closet with a ventless Bosch washer/dryer and central A/C and heating. The building: The Cobble Hill School Condo is 5-story elevator building, with a beautiful common roof deck with spectacular sweeping harbor views of the Manhattan skyline, Downtown Brooklyn and brownstone Brooklyn. The building offers a video intercom system, a private storage unit, inside or outside bike storage and a common laundry room. The building can be entered on Cheever Place (44 Cheever Place) through the building’s private gated parking lot or through Hicks Street (501 Hicks Street). The location: Located on one of Cobble Hill’s coveted Place blocks, you are a close to Cobble Hill Park, the Brooklyn waterfront, Brooklyn Bridge Park, the Brooklyn Greenway, lively shops and restaurants in all directions. There are nearby express trains at Borough Hall (2/3/4/5/N/R), and the F/G subway lines at Bergen and Carroll. Citi Bike and easy access to the BQE make any commute easy
